site stats

How to learn cpu architecture

WebPrinciples of processors, control units, and storage systems. Registers, buses, microprogramming, virtual storage. Relationship between computer architecture and system software. Learning Outcomes Describe computer architecture concepts and mechanisms related to the design of modern processors and memories, and explain … Web3 jul. 2024 · How to design your own CPU from scratch (4 parts) Here I plan to design a really simple 8-Bit CPU from scratch, only using low-level logic and low-level components. I’ll also discuss the main parts of a CPU and maybe I’ll discuss extended features and pipelining at the end of the series or in a future article.

How to find the processor / chip architecture on Linux

WebLFD111x is a crash course in digital logic design and basic CPU microarchitecture. Using the Makerchip online integrated development environment (IDE), you will implement everything from logic gates to a simple, but complete, RISC-V CPU core. You will be amazed by what you can do using freely-available online tools for open source … Web22 feb. 2013 · VLSI professional with 12 years of engineering experience in the semiconductor industry. Experienced in CPU architecture, microarchitecture exploration, subsystem architecture, CPU subsystem DV architecture, emulation for CPU performance projections, post silicon bring up of chip & mobile workload analysis on android … maverick truck ford 2022 https://artattheplaza.net

Learn the Architecture - A-profile – Arm®

Web7 jul. 2016 · NUMA Deep Dive Part 1: From UMA to NUMA. Non-uniform memory access (NUMA) is a shared memory architecture used in today’s multiprocessing systems. Each CPU is assigned its own local memory and can access memory from other CPUs in the system. Local memory access provides a low latency – high bandwidth performance. WebWhite Paper: Describes the basic operation and function of platform ingredients and critical support components used in three classes of Intel® architecture platforms, including the Intel® Atom™ and Intel® Core™ processors. (v.1, Jan. 2014) WebA high-level overview of modern CPU architectures indicates it is all about low latency memory access by using significant cache memory layers. Let’s first take a look at a diagram that shows an generic, memory focussed, modern CPU package ( note: the precise lay-out strongly depends on vendor/model). maverick trucking company application

Architecture All Access: Modern CPU Architecture Part 2 ... - YouTube

Category:What Is Computer Architecture? – Get Education

Tags:How to learn cpu architecture

How to learn cpu architecture

linux - What

Web11 sep. 2024 · Comparing CPU vs GPU architecture, we can see that the two components are designed for very different purposes. CPUs are designed for complex, ‘serial’ (step-by-step) processing, and GPUs are designed for simple, ‘parallel’ (simultaneous) processing. GPUs share similar designs to CPUs in some ways, however. WebA machine has a 32-bit architecture, with 1-word long instructions. It has 64 registers, each of which is 32 bits long. It needs to support 45 instructions, which have an immediate operand in addition to two register operands. Assuming that the immediate operand is an unsigned integer, the maximum value of the immediate operand is

How to learn cpu architecture

Did you know?

Web25 mrt. 2024 · We now ask ourself why PCs are still based on CPUs and not entirely made of GPUs. The answer is that a CPUs work in a totally different way than GPUs and the … WebCourse format: The course consists of six modules, each comprising a series of video lectures, and a project. You will need about 2-3 hours to watch each module's lectures, and about 5-10 hours to complete each one of the six projects. The course can be completed in six weeks, but you are welcome to take it at your own pace.

WebLearn how to process instructions efficiently and explore how to achieve higher data throughput with data-level parallelism. Continue your Computer Architecture learning journey with Computer Architecture: Parallel Computing. Learn about superscalar processors and how they are used to improve the processing of instructions. Then dive … Web10 apr. 2024 · Learn about processor architecture and bus topology, arbitration, encoding, standards, and optimization techniques to improve computer system performance.

Web6 okt. 2024 · 2) (Jongware) You can see opcodes (common patterns of bytes) without actually knowing what are them pretty much the same way you can determine if a file is compressed or encrypted without being able to decrypt or decompress it. – joxeankoret Oct 8, 2013 at 13:14 @jongware I think that you confuse opcode with assembler instruction. … Web13 apr. 2024 · Nowhere is this more evident than in their 13th generation of computer processors, codenamed “Raptor Lake.” Not only do they utilize an exciting new hybrid architecture, but they also represent an unprecedented leap forward in the world of mobile CPUs - and that’s on top of their equally impressive desktop CPUs.

WebToday be logical and process these fun facts about CPU'S. Central Processing Units have an interesting history and evolution. Learn some interesting facts in...

Web28 mrt. 2024 · These are some of the main memory types in CPU architecture, but there are also other types such as virtual memory, flash memory, etc. Each memory type has its own advantages and disadvantages depending on the application requirements. Choosing the right memory type for your CPU design can improve its performance, power … hermanophyton for saleWeb25 mei 2024 · The Pineapple One is a complete computer with input/output, memory, and a homebrew 32-bit RISC-V CPU. It's a certain kind of itch that drives people to voluntarily build their own CPU. We start ... herman olivera shamanWeb30 okt. 2024 · As you learn more about computer architecture, you will probably develop an interest in specific areas of study, some questions you want to answer, and some … maverick trucking incWeb25 mrt. 2024 · We now ask ourself why PCs are still based on CPUs and not entirely made of GPUs. The answer is that a CPUs work in a totally different way than GPUs and the figure below helps us understanding... maverick trucking johnstown ohioWebtuning of processor architectures is treated. Several advanced Multi-Processor Platforms, combining discussed processors, are treated. A set of 3 mandatory very advanced lab exercises complements this course. Purpose: This course aims at getting an understanding of the processor maverick trucking phone numberWebI specialize mostly in Rust programming language. I a researcher and developing complex solutions for blockchain, ide tools, compilers and more. Developer: Web apps, Mobile apps, Video chats, Photo apps, Backend services. Built mobile browser alternative called Animation CPU. My technical background is excellent. maverick truckingWebTo be specific, the CPU arch is "EM64T" or "Intel 64", both of which fall under "amd64" in the Linux kernel (although they are not copies of AMD64). – Ignacio Vazquez-Abrams Jul 4, 2012 at 10:27 2 @IgnacioVazquez-Abrams, it's Intel's implementation of AMD64, indeed called Intel 64, IA-32e or whatever else. hermanophyton